The Story of Naomie
Naomie is a French-influenced spelling of Naomi, a Hebrew name meaning 'pleasantness' or 'my delight.' In the Bible's Book of Ruth, Naomi is the mother-in-law of Ruth and a central figure in a story of loyalty, loss, and redemption. After losing her husband and sons, Naomi tried to rename herself Mara ('bitter'), saying 'call me no more Naomi' — but the name Naomi endured. The added 'e' reflects French orthographic tradition.
Naomi has seen steady international popularity, boosted by supermodel Naomi Campbell in the 1990s and tennis champion Naomi Osaka in the 2010s-2020s. The French spelling Naomie offers a subtle distinction within this popular name.
In Hebrew tradition, Naomi is a beloved biblical matriarch whose story of loyalty and redemption is told in the Book of Ruth — one of only two books of the Bible named after women. The name is cherished across Jewish, Christian, and Muslim communities.

About the Name Naomie
Naomie is a girl name with French, English, Jewish, and African American origins . The name means "pleasantness, sweetness" in Hebrew .
Naomie is currently ranked #3,081 in popularity for girl names in the United States.
The name Naomie has 3 syllables, making it distinctive and memorable.
Common nicknames for Naomie include Nomi and Mie. These shorter forms provide casual alternatives while keeping the elegance of the full name.
Alternative spellings of Naomie include Naomi, Naomy . Each spelling variation gives the name a slightly different character while preserving its sound and meaning.
